Traditionally, the Kentucky Derby—which takes place this today and tomorrow—is a time to leisurely place gentlemanly bets on horse races, sip tasty Mint Juleps, and display a dapper ensemble that calls to mind the classic, genteel Southern charms of yore. For ladies, it's also an excuse to wear a hulking, embellished, and ridiculous chapeau—but why should the girls have all the fun? A quick look at the spring 2012 runways shows that there was a plethora of outlandish acts of millinery begging to top of an otherwise pedestrian outfit. Here, we feature just a few of the options—from a regal jeweled crown to a gypsyfied baseball cap—available to men who'd like to prove that their own sartorial savvy can easily eclipse the glamour of a wide-brimmed socialite's topsy-turvy topper.
